.time-box-warning[data-v-04549890],.time-box-warning[data-v-68051318]{background-color:rgba(var(--vs-warning),1)!important;color:#fff;border-radius:6px;width:100px;border:1px #000;padding:5px;margin:2px;text-align:center;float:left}.sidesheet .vs-sidebar{min-width:450px!important}@media (max-width:576px){.sidesheet .vs-sidebar{min-width:unset!important}}.activity-collapse>.vs-collapse-item>.vs-collapse-item--header{padding:0!important}.activity-collapse>.vs-collapse-item .open-item>.vs-collapse-item--content{max-height:100%!important}.fc-agendaDay-button,.fc-agendaWeek-button,.fc-month-button,.fc-today-button{display:none!important}.application-action{float:left!important}.time-box{background-color:#d3d3d3;width:100px;border:1px #000;padding:5px;margin:2px;text-align:center;float:left}.vs-table--tbody{z-index:1!important}.vdp-datepicker{z-index:2}.vdp-datepicker__calendar{right:0}.tooltip{position:relative;display:inline-block;border-bottom:1px dotted #000}.tooltip .tooltiptext{visibility:hidden;width:120px;background-color:#000;color:#fff;text-align:center;border-radius:6px;padding:5px 0;position:absolute;z-index:1}.tooltip:hover .tooltiptext{visibility:visible}.datepicker-main{-webkit-box-align:center;-ms-flex-align:center;align-items:center;width:auto}.datepicker-main,.datewrapper{display:-webkit-box;display:-ms-flexbox;display:flex}.datewrapper label{float:right;text-align:right;line-height:40px;padding-right:10px;font-size:14px!important;font-weight:700}.sidesheet .vs-sidebar{max-width:450px!important;z-index:99999!important}.total-hours{border:1px solid rgba(0,0,0,.2);padding:.7rem;border-radius:5px;margin-bottom:10px}.vs-table--search{margin:0!important}.feather-download,.feather-file-text,.feather-printer{width:16px;height:16px}.activity-table{max-height:300px;overflow-x:auto}.center-col{border-left:1px solid #e7e7e7!important;border-right:1px solid #e7e7e7!important}.fc-toolbar h2{font-size:18px;font-weight:700;color:#666}.fc-event,.fc-event-dot{background-color:#3aad68}.fc-event .fcc-content{padding-left:3px}.fc-unthemed td.fc-today{background:#3f57fe;color:#fff}.fc-unthemed td.fc-past{background:#ff9000}.fc-toolbar{text-align:right}.hide{display:none}.activity-table .header-table{-webkit-box-pack:end!important;-ms-flex-pack:end!important;justify-content:flex-end!important}.status-table{margin-top:58px}.sidesheet .vs-sidebar--background{z-index:99999!important}.sidesheet .header-sidebar{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.sidesheet .header-sidebar,.sidesheet .header-sidebar h4{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;width:100%}.sidesheet .header-sidebar h4>button{margin-left:10px}.sidesheet .footer-sidebar{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;width:100%}.sidesheet .footer-sidebar>button{border:0 solid transparent!important;border-left:1px solid rgba(0,0,0,.07)!important;border-radius:0!important}.delete-timesheet{margin:16px 0;padding:0 20px}.sidesheet .vs-sidebar--items{height:756px;overflow-y:scroll}.vs-table .vs-table--thead .td-check{width:1%}.d-flex{display:-webkit-box!important;display:-ms-flexbox!important;display:flex!important}.fw600{width:180px;font-weight:600!important;font-size:14px}.nxt-prv-btn{height:25px;width:30px;background:#fff;border:1px solid #000;color:#000}.nxt-prv-btn:hover{color:#000!important}.date-wrapper{-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.date-wrapper button{cursor:pointer}.date-wrapper button:not(:disabled):hover{color:#535353!important}.date-wrapper button:disabled{background:#c3c3c3;cursor:auto}.con-ul-tabs{padding:30px!important}.common-tabs{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-ms-flex-wrap:wrap;flex-wrap:wrap}.common-tabs .one{width:360px}.common-tabs .two{width:calc(100% - 634px)}